Understanding the Basics: Carbs and Your Energy
Carbohydrates are crucial for fueling your body and brain. When you eat carbs, your body breaks them down into glucose, which is used for immediate energy or stored as glycogen in your liver and muscles for later use. The rate at which food releases glucose into your bloodstream is measured by its Glycemic Index (GI). Foods with a high GI cause a rapid blood sugar spike, providing quick energy but potentially leading to a crash. Conversely, low-GI foods release energy slowly and steadily, offering sustained fuel. This is the key difference when deciding what's better for energy, rice or pasta.
The Refined Carbohydrate Showdown: White Rice vs. White Pasta
At first glance, white rice and white pasta seem similar. However, their physical structures lead to different energy responses in the body. White rice is a refined grain that lacks its bran and germ, which significantly reduces its fiber content. This makes it quick to digest and gives it a high GI score (often over 70). The result is a fast-acting energy boost, which can be useful immediately after an intense workout to replenish glycogen stores. The downside is that without fiber to slow down digestion, this quick energy is often followed by a slump.
White pasta, typically made from durum wheat semolina, also consists of refined grains, but its dense, compact structure slows down digestion. This gives it a significantly lower GI than white rice (a study found plain spaghetti has a GI of 44). When cooked al dente (firm to the bite), this effect is even more pronounced. The result is a more gradual and sustained energy release, helping to avoid the sudden sugar spike and crash associated with white rice. This makes it a great option for fueling up an hour or two before a long workout.
The Whole Grain Advantage: Brown Rice vs. Whole Wheat Pasta
For truly sustained energy, the whole grain versions are the clear winners. Brown rice retains its bran and germ, making it rich in fiber, vitamins, and minerals. The higher fiber content slows down digestion, resulting in a lower GI than white rice (around 50-55) and a more stable energy release. Brown rice is also naturally gluten-free, making it a suitable option for those with celiac disease or gluten intolerance.
Whole wheat pasta is made from the entire wheat kernel, giving it a much higher fiber content than white pasta. It has an even lower GI (around 40) and provides more protein and fiber, promoting a feeling of fullness for longer. For endurance athletes, whole wheat pasta can be an excellent choice for a pre-race meal to ensure steady, long-lasting fuel.
Nutritional Comparison: Rice vs. Pasta Varieties
This table compares the typical nutritional profiles per 100g of cooked rice or pasta, highlighting their differences as energy sources.
| Feature | White Rice | Brown Rice | White Pasta | Whole Wheat Pasta |
|---|---|---|---|---|
| Energy Release | Fast | Slow-Sustained | Slow-Sustained | Slow-Sustained |
| Glycemic Index | High (64-93) | Medium (50-55) | Low (40-55) | Low (around 40) |
| Fiber (per 100g) | Low (approx. 0.4g) | High (approx. 1.8g) | Medium (approx. 1.2g) | High (approx. 3.4g) |
| Protein (per 100g) | Low (approx. 1.4g) | Medium (approx. 1.8g) | Medium (approx. 5.1g) | High (approx. 5.3g) |
| Key Minerals | Fortified | Manganese, Magnesium | Fortified | Manganese, Magnesium |
| Best for | Quick glycogen refill | Balanced meals, digestion | Pre-workout fuel | Endurance, satiety |
Strategic Use for Optimal Performance
Choosing between rice and pasta for energy should be a strategic decision based on timing. For endurance athletes, a meal with lower-GI carbs, like whole wheat pasta, consumed a few hours before an event, provides a steady and prolonged energy supply. For a quick recovery meal immediately after a workout, when your body is primed to rapidly replenish muscle glycogen, a high-GI option like white rice can be beneficial. For everyday energy, incorporating whole grain versions of both provides a consistent, stable fuel source. The high fiber content also aids in weight management by increasing satiety.
Bonus Tip: The Power of Resistant Starch A fascinating nutritional hack involves cooking and then cooling your rice or pasta. The cooling process converts some of the starch into 'resistant starch'. As the name suggests, resistant starch is not easily digested, and acts more like fiber in the body, which further lowers the GI and slows energy release. Reheating the pasta or rice can enhance this effect even more.

Factors Influencing Your Choice
- Timing: Consider when you need the energy. White rice is best immediately after high-intensity exercise, while whole grain pasta is better for sustained energy before a long activity.
- Grain Type: Prioritize whole grains like brown rice and whole wheat pasta for long-term health and stable energy, as they contain more fiber and micronutrients.
- Blood Sugar Management: For individuals needing to manage blood sugar, whole grain pasta's lower GI and higher fiber content is generally the more favorable choice.
- Added Nutrients: Remember that the other ingredients in your meal (proteins, fats, and vegetables) also affect digestion and energy release. Pairing any carbohydrate with protein and healthy fats will slow absorption.
